Abstract

PROBLEM TO BE SOLVED: To provide golf gloves composed of a specific warp knitted fabric impregnated with resin, enabling the outer appearance of suede to show excellent grade and excellent in the touch, durability, a feeling in wearing the gloves and a fit feeling to fingers. SOLUTION: The golf gloves are composed of a resin-impregnated warp knitted fabric having <=30% longitudinal elongation at break and 2-6 balanced ratio of transverse elongation at break to longitudinal one. Warps are placed in the longitudinal direction of the glove, and part or the whole of the warp knitted fabric is composed of multifilament yarns each made of only flat filaments having >=2 oblateness. The multifilament yarn is composed of polyamide filaments having a monofilament fineness of 0.01-0.2 deniers and polyester filaments having a monofilament fineness of 0.02-0.5 deniers both produced by delaminating/splitting a delamination-type hollow splittable yarn where the blend ratio of a polyamide constituent 2 to a polyester constituent 1 is (20-40 wt.%):(80-60 wt.%).

It is important that the warp knitted fabric according to the golf glove of the present invention has a warp elongation of 30% or less and a ratio of elongation in the weft direction / elongation in the warp direction of 2-6. . By using such a requirement, when using the golf club, it does not extend in the length direction of the finger, but extends in the direction around the finger, so that it has an excellent feeling of fitting to human fingers and a very good wearing feeling. Become. Accordingly, if the elongation in the warp direction exceeds 30%, the grip of the glove shaft in a state where the finger is bent is lacking. Preferably 1
0 to 20%. If the ratio of the elongation in the weft direction / the elongation in the meridian direction is less than 2, a feeling of pressure is exerted around the finger, and conversely 6
If it exceeds, the fit around the fingers is lost and the feeling of wearing is reduced. Preferably it is 3-5. The warp direction in the present invention refers to the warp direction of the warp knitted fabric, and the weft direction refers to the weft direction of the warp knitted fabric.

Next, it is important that the warp knitted fabric according to the present invention is partially or entirely composed of a multifilament yarn composed of only flat cross-section filaments having a flatness of 2 or more. This is because the bending stiffness of the fabric is weak and the fabric is soft, so that gloves having an excellent sense of fitting to human hands and an extremely excellent wearing feeling can be obtained. When the oblateness is less than 2, the bending rigidity is increased and the fit is reduced. Preferably it is 3-6. What is important here is that the multifilament yarn is constituted by a multifilament yarn consisting of only flat-section filaments. That is, when a multifilament yarn containing a filament yarn having an aspect ratio of less than 2 is used even in part, the bending rigidity of the fabric increases, the fit during play decreases, and the intended purpose of the present invention is reduced. It is difficult to achieve.

[0008] The flat cross-section filament is preferably composed of a polyamide filament and a polyester filament. This is to make a golf glove having high fabric strength and excellent durability. The mixing ratio of the polyamide filament and the polyester filament is preferably 20 to 40% by weight / 80 to 60% by weight. Furthermore, the single filament denier of the polyamide filament is 0.01
The polyester filament preferably has a single yarn denier of 0.02 to 0.5 d / f. This is because the bending rigidity of the fabric is weak and a soft touch can be obtained.

Next, a production example of the golf glove according to the present invention will be described. First, a release-type hollow split yarn having a mixing ratio of a polyamide component and a polyester component of 20 to 40% by weight: 80 to 60% by weight is arranged on all or any one of the warp knitting machines having two or more reeds. And knit the warp knitted fabric. As the knitting structure, any of known structures can be adopted, but a tricot knitted fabric is preferable. 50-100 hollow split fibers
Denier is preferable, and the number of filaments is 18 to 36.
Is preferred. Other reeds include polyester, polyamide,
Etc. can be provided. The obtained warp knitted fabric is subjected to brushing, relaxing scouring, dyeing, drying and finishing setting, etc., to be finished. At that time, the hollow split yarn is separated and split into various components by raising and dyeing, and the polyamide component is a fiber of 0.01 to 0.2 d / f, and the polyester component is a fiber of 0.02 to 0.5 d / f. And each of the fibers has a wedge-shaped cross section and is an extremely fine flat yarn having a flatness of 2 or more.

[0010] Further, the obtained warp-knitted fabric is impregnated with a resin such as a urethane resin. At this time, it is important to increase the width in the weft direction while applying tension in the warp direction in the subsequent hot water washing step. Specifically, 5 in the warp direction
Process by adding a draft of 2525%, preferably 10-15%. By performing impregnation under such conditions, a warp knitted fabric subjected to urethane impregnation, in which the warp elongation is 30% or less and the ratio of weft elongation / warp elongation is balanced at 2 to 6. This is because it becomes possible to obtain Thereafter, the above-described warp knitted fabric is cut so that the shape of a human finger is in the warp direction of the knitted fabric and sewn to manufacture a golf glove. Therefore, in the obtained glove, the warp is arranged in the warp direction of the glove. This is because when the knitted fabric is cut in the lateral direction, the fit of the fingers is reduced.
